Biographical notes:

Architect, botanist and politician. Fellow of the Royal and Linnean Societies of England, and for some years Secretary of the Royal Society of Tasmania, he named many Tasmanian plants and assisted Dr. Hooker with Flora Tasmaniae. From 1856-1858 he worked at the Herbarium, Kew Gardens. Several times Member of the House of Assembly, Tasmania 1851-1866.
